“It’s just a local custom.”

Hong Sancai said: “It is said that a water snake takes five hundred years to turn into a flood dragon. The flood dragon hides in lakes, deep pools, tributaries of rivers, or underground caves. After cultivating for five hundred years and surviving the trial, it travels along the great river to the Eastern Sea, where it can ascend to beco a dragon. The process of becoming a dragon can be called either flood dragon crossing or water crossing.”

“If such a water crossing happens in the human world, the flood dragon must pass through certain paths to enter the great river. If it goes near the rivers in the civic district, the big waves it stirs might destroy houses and harm the civic district. That’s why locals hang a sword under the bridge. If a flood dragon does water crossing, it won’t pass through that place again.”

“Of course, this is only a legend. Even the City God has never heard of a flood dragon’s water crossing happening.”
